Output 35b6049fa53f4ddb02c31a83ee656f691a72ab3ef69af2de833d2490603eaa09:4

value
2887212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3bc176da449fb7be6677c1de3babdc1cfef574c OP_EQUAL
address
3J5NCi5eYDj9YJMYXqiqgRdidSNYtqHZmJ
transaction
35b6049fa53f4ddb02c31a83ee656f691a72ab3ef69af2de833d2490603eaa09
spent
true